Bungeecord and Health Scoreboards

Discussion in 'Spigot Plugin Development' started by rgaminecraft, Jun 20, 2015.

  1. I have a problem with some code I wrote trying to get the health of a player to display under their name. I have two servers (On on bungee and one direct) and the code works fine on the non-bungee server. However, once I load it onto the bungee server everyones health always '0'. Is there a different way you have to register players with Spigot/Bungee?

    Here is my code:
    Code (Text):


            oNoPartyScoreboard = Bukkit.getScoreboardManager().getNewScoreboard();
            oObjective = oNoPartyScoreboard.registerNewObjective("HBars-NoParty", "health");
            oObjective.setDisplaySlot(DisplaySlot.BELOW_NAME);
            oObjective.setDisplayName("/ 20 " + ChatColor.RED + "❤");

           -------------------------------

           oPC.getPlayer().setScoreboard(oNoPartyScoreboard);

           -------------------------------

            for (Player oPlayer : Bukkit.getServer().getOnlinePlayers()) {
                Score scorePlayer = oObjective.getScore(oPlayer.getName());
                scorePlayer.setScore((int)oPlayer.getHealth());
               }
     
     
  2. Dang, I wish I could code :p So I can help people like you :p
     
  3. Has anyone been able to get this working behind bungee?